android - future 日期的 DateUtils.getRelativeTimeSpanString
全部标签 我使用臭名昭著的jQueryUI的日期选择器,在我的表单中我选择了两个日期范围。第一个代表开始日期,另一个代表结束日期。我现在需要的是计算这两个日期之间每个星期一的算法、一些提示和说明或帮助程序。例如:start:2011-06-01end:2011-06-30应该为我提取星期一的这4(四)个日期:1st:2011-06-062nd:2011-06-133rd:2011-06-204th:2011-06-27我怎样才能做到这一点?而且,我每两周的星期一都需要它:每两周的结果应该是:1st:2011-06-062rd:2011-06-20 最佳答案
验证我的XMLsitemap时,谷歌说:无效日期发现无效日期。请在重新提交前修正日期或格式。我通过以下方式转换mysql时间戳:gmdate('Y-m-d\TH:i:s',strtotime($row['modified']['value'])) 最佳答案 'lastmod'元素必须采用YYYY-MM-DD或YYYY-MM-DDThh:mmTZD格式,因此请使用:gmdate('Y-m-d',strtotime($row['modified']['value']))或gmdate('Y-m-d\TH:i:s+00:00',strto
我有两个包含日期字符串的变量,格式为$four_days_have_passed="07-14-2013";$now="07-10-2013";我已经检查了FirePHP中的输出,日期是正确的。然后我尝试这样比较它们,if(strtotime($now)为什么IF语句中的代码永远不会执行? 最佳答案 如果你想使用MM/DD/YYYY格式你需要/分隔符。$four_days_have_passed="07/14/2013";$now="07/10/2013";Fromthemanual:-Datesinthem/d/yord-m-yf
我已经看到很多关于此的问题/帖子,但尚未找到合适的解决方案。基本上我正在尝试做wp_get_archives所做的事情,但是对于自定义帖子类型(我个人不确定为什么wp_get_archives不支持自定义帖子类型!)。我目前使用的代码如下函数.phpfunctionCpt_getarchives_where_filter($where,$r){$post_type='events';returnstr_replace("post_type='post'","post_type='$post_type'",$where);}sidebar-events.phpadd_filter('ge
我有一个字符串-15/09/201512:00-[Day/Month/Year]格式,我想把它转换成Year-Month-Day[mysqldatetimeformat].我尝试使用以下内容:$myDateTime=$myDateTime->createFromFormat('d/m/YH:i','15/09/201512:00');$newDateString=$myDateTime->format('Y-m-dH:i');但它会引发内部服务器错误。 最佳答案 使用DateTime类调用函数createFromFormat静态函数
我需要将日期保存到Excel文件,它必须以“dd/mm/yyyy”格式(或用户的本地日期格式)输出,并被视为日期,以便其中的一列可以正确排序。代码如下:getActiveSheet();PHPExcel_Shared_Font::setAutoSizeMethod(PHPExcel_Shared_Font::AUTOSIZE_METHOD_EXACT);//Ididn'tfinddd/mm/yyyyformat,soIusedyyyy-mm-dd$sheet->setCellValueByColumnAndRow(0,1,"2014-10-16");$sheet->getStyleBy
严重性:8192消息:在未来的PHP版本中,与类同名的方法将不再是构造函数;CI_Pagination有一个已弃用的构造函数文件名:libraries/Pagination.php行号:27classCI_Pagination{var$base_url='';//Thepagewearelinkingtovar$total_rows='';//Totalnumberofitems(databaseresults)var$per_page=10;//Maxnumberofitemsyouwantshownperpagevar$num_links=2;//Numberof"digit"li
我发现strtotime()有一些奇怪的地方。对于不存在的日期,它返回后一天。$d30=strtotime("2017-06-30");Echo$d30."\n";Echodate("Y-m-d",$d30)."\n\n";//2017-06-30$d31=strtotime("2017-06-31");Echo$d31."\n";Echodate("Y-m-d",$d31)."\n\n";//2017-07-01$d32=strtotime("2017-06-32");Echo$d32."\n";Echodate("Y-m-d",$d32);//1970-01-01https://3
我建立了一个小论坛,用户可以在其中发帖。我的服务器在美国,但论坛的用户群在台湾(+15小时)。当有人向表单发帖时,我将时间以YYYY-MM-DDHH:MM:SS格式存储在我的mySQL数据库中。当我查看数据库时,时间显示正确的时间(台湾人发布的时间)。但是,当我使用UNIX_TIMESTAMP从数据库中获取日期时,时间发生了变化。例子:我在论坛上发了一些东西。我watch上的日期时间是2009-10-211:24am(台湾时间)我查看数据库,它说日期时间是2009年10月2日上午11:24(与我的watch时间相同。很好!)然后当我使用UNIX_TIMESTAMP在我的网站上显示日期时
我正在使用unix时间戳来显示消息在我的项目中发布的时间,但是当我显示发布的确切时间时,我意识到它晚了大约12小时。我在英国,我的服务器在美国(可能是问题所在)。有没有一种简单的方法可以将unix时间戳转换为可读的英国时间?$timestamp=time();printdate("FjS,Y",strtotime($timestamp));任何帮助都会很棒,谢谢! 最佳答案 在脚本的顶部,写:date_default_timezone_set('Europe/London');或ifyourPHPis>=5.2.0:date_tim